Welcome to Riverwalk Dental!

My name is Claudia Quan. I was born in Miami, Florida, and moved to Santa Fe the summer after 7th grade. I graduated from St. Michael’s High School and went on to receive a Bachelor of Science from The University of New Mexico. In 2014, I graduated from the University of Colorado School of Dental Medicine. After dental school, I moved back to New Mexico to complete a postdoctoral Advanced Education in General Dentistry (AEGD) residency at UNM. After living away from home for so many years, I am blessed to be back and honored to serve patients from Santa Fe and surrounding areas.

My love for dentistry became a reality after I graduated from college in 2006. I started working as a pediatric dental assistant and immediately fell in love with dentistry. From my first day as a dental assistant, I knew I wanted to become a dentist. My favorite aspects of dentistry are working with my hands and educating patients on the importance of a healthy mouth and the connection between oral health and a healthy body.

When I’m not at the office you can find me at the park with my daughter, running outdoors with my fiancé, grabbing a cup of coffee from a local coffee shop, and enjoying family time.
